Pilot Talk
Curren$y
"Pilot Talk" lands with the complete confidence of a work that knows exactly what it is — Curren$y's most refined statement of his own aesthetic, the aviation metaphors and weed diplomacy and Jet Life philosophy reaching a synthesis that sounds effortless because it was actually painstaking. The production is lush and airy, keyboards floating above drums that barely intrude, creating a soundscape that matches the altitude of the concept. Curren$y's flow here is at its most conversational — the line between rapping and simply speaking his mind dissolved to the point where the distinction stops mattering. The flying metaphor isn't labored or explained; it's simply inhabited, the whole track operating at cruising altitude as though descent is not among the available options. Lyrically the song establishes coordinates for the entire Pilot Talk project — ambition framed as navigation, success as destination reached through preparation and the right instruments. The New Orleans provenance is present in the warmth of the production and the storytelling patience of the delivery, a Southern lineage that Curren$y wears lightly. A gateway track for the uninitiated and a comfort track for the already converted — a rare combination that only happens when an artist has fully arrived at themselves.
